    As per ISO 6520-1987 Welding discontinuitiesare divided in following six groups

    Group Designated Defect

    1 Cracks2 Cavities

    3 Solid Inclusions

    4 Lack of Fusion &penetration

    5 Imperfect Shape

    6 Miscellaneous defects

    CRACKS Crack is a tight linear separation of metal that

    can be very short to very long indications

    Cracks are grouped as hot or cold cracks.

    Hot cracks usually occur as the metal solidifies

    at elevated temperatures.

    Cold cracks occur after the metal has cooled to

    ambient temperatures ( delayed cracks).

    Causes Remedies

    Highly restrained joint Preheat, Stress relief, welding sequence change

    Excessive dilution Change welding current & speed, use DC-, buttering

    Defective electrodes or

    flux

    Use new electrodes or flux, check baking cycle

    Poor fit up Reduce root opening, build up edges

    Small weld bead Increase electrode size, raise welding current, reducespeed

    High S in base metal Use low-S filler

    Crater cracking Fill crater before extinguishing arc

    Angular distortion Change to balanced welding

    Causes & Remedies- Weld Cracking

    Porosity appears often as dark round irregular spots in clusters orrows. Sometimes it is elongated and may have an appearance of a

    tail. This is the result of gas attempting to escape while the metal is

    still in a liquid state & is called wormhole porosity. All porosity is

    indeed a void will have a darker density than the surrounding.

    Cluster porosity is caused when electrodes are contaminated withmoisture or hydrocarbon. It appears like regular porosity in a filmbut the indications will be grouped close together.

    Causes & Remedies of Porosity

    Causes Remedies

    Excessive H2,N2,O2 in

    welding atmosphere

    Use low-H2 electrodes, high deoxider fillers,

    increase shielding gas flow

    High solidification rate Use preheat or increase heat input

    Dirty base metal Clean joint face and adjacent surfaces

    Improper arc length.

    Welding current or

    electrode manipulation

    Change welding conditions or techniques

    Galvanized steel Use E6010 electrodes and volatilize zinc ahead of

    weld pool

    Excessive moisture in

    electrode

    Check baking and storing of electrodes, Preheat

    base metal

    Slag Inclusions are the nonmetallic solid materials trapped inweld or between the weld and base metal. In a radiograph, dark,

    jagged asymmetrical shapes within the weld or along the weld joint

    areas are indicative of slag inclusions.

    Tungsten inclusions.Tungsten is a brittle and dense material used

    as an electrode in tungsten inert gas welding. If an incorrect welding

    procedures & skill is performed, then only the tungsten gets trapped.

    Radiographically, tungsten is more dense than aluminum or steel;

    therefore, it shows as a lighter area with a distinct outline on the

    radiograph

    Oxide inclusions are usually visible on the surface of a weld mtal

    (especially aluminum). Oxide inclusions are less dense than the surr -ounding metals and, thus it appears as dark irregular shaped discon

    -tinuity in radiograph. This is also referred as puckering in ISO.

    Lack of Fusion and Penetration

    Lack of side wall fusion is a condition where the weld metal doesnot fuse with the base metal. Appearance on radiograph is usually a

    darker line or lines oriented in the direction of the weld seam along

    the weld joining area.

    Lack of interrun fusion is a condition where the weld metal doesnot fuse with the base metal or the previous weld bead (interpass

    cold lap). The arc does not melt the base metal and causes the

    molten puddle to flow into the base metal without the proper

    bonding.

    Undercut is an erosion of the base metal next to the toe of the weldface. It appears in radiograph as a dark irregular line on outer edge

    of the weld.

    Root undercut is an erosion of the base metal next to the root of theweld. It appears in radiographic images as a dark irregular line offset

    from the centerline of the weldment. Undercutting is not as straight

    edged as LOP because it does not follow the straight edge

    Root concavity or suck backis a condition where the weld metalhas contracted as it cools down & has been drawn up into the root of

    the weld. On a film it appears similar to the lack of root penetration

    but the line has irregular wide edges and placed in the middle.

    Excessive reinforcement is an area of a weld added in excess ofthat specified by the drawings and codes. The appearance on a

    radiograph is a localized & less darker area. A visual examination

    will easily determine if the weld reinforcement is in excess.

    Misalignment: The radiographic image is a noticeable difference in

    density between the two mismatched pieces. The difference in

    density is caused by the difference in material thickness. The dark,

    straight line is caused by failure of the weld metal to fuse with the

    land area.

    Burn through (icicles) results when too much heat causes weld topierce through. Lumps of weld metal sag through the seam creating

    a thick globular condition on the root face. On a radiograph, burn

    through appears as dark spots surrounded by light globular areas.

    Whiskers are the short lengths of electrode wire, visible onthe top or bottom surfaces of the weld or contained within the

    weld. On radiograph they appear as light, "wire like" indications.
